/* -----------------------行噛、ップwｦｉ"・・莽----------------------- */
.heightup120 { line-height: 120% }
.heightup140 { line-height: 140% }
/* -----------------------行噛、ップwｦｉ"・梳届----------------------- */

/* -----------------------瀦咲"磨潟塔N形ｮｉ"・・莽----------------------- */
A:link { color:#000099; text-decoration:underline; }
A:hover { color:#3366FF; text-decoration:none; }
/* -----------------------瀦咲"磨潟塔N形ｮｉ"・梳届----------------------- */

/* --------------------フォントサイズｖ詣剃・・・莽---------------------- */
.FontSize1 {  font-size: 8pt }
.FontSize2 {  font-size: 10pt }
.FontSize3 {  font-size: 12pt }
.FontSize4 {  font-size: 14pt }
/* --------------------フォントサイズｖ詣剃・・梳届---------------------- */


/* -------------------トップページ燕灯白リンク色ｉ"・・莽------------------- */

.white-link { }
A.white-link:link { color: #FFFFFF; text-decoration:none; }
A.white-link:active { color: #FFFFFF; text-decoration:none; }
A.white-link:visited { color: #FFFFFF; text-decoration:none; }
A.white-link:hover { color: #FFFFFF; text-decoration:underline; }

/* -------------------トップページ燕灯白リンク色ｉ"・梳届------------------- */

/* ---------------------フォーム澄2艾尠Aｗ"・・・・・枯--------------------- */

.input { background: #FFFF66 ; color: #000000 ;font-weight: normal; font-size: 12px; width: 60px; }

.input-nowidth { background: #FFFF66 ; color: #000000 ;font-weight: normal; font-size: 12px; }

.select { color: #000000; background: #FFFF66; font-weight: normal; font-size: 12px; } 

.botton { background: #FFFF66 ; color: #000000 ;font-weight: normal; font-size: 12px; }

/* ---------------------フォーム澄2艾尠Aｗ"・・梳・・枯--------------------- */

.table1,
.table2,
.table3{
	color:#fff;
	font-size:90%;
	background-color:#06c;
	line-height:160%;
	background-image:url(../images/kado.gif);
	background-position:right bottom;
	background-repeat:no-repeat;
}
.table1 td,
.table2 td,
.table3 td{
	vertical-align:top;
	padding:5px;
}
.table1 td h3,
.table2 td h3,
.table3 td h3{
	margin:0 0 10px 0;
	padding:0;
	font-size:130%;
}
.table1 td ul,
.table2 td ul,
.table3 td ul{
	list-style:circle;
}

.point,.job{
	margin:10px 0;
	line-height:160%;
}
.point dt,
.job dt{
	border-bottom:#666 solid 1px;
}
.point dd,
.job dd{
	margin:0;
}
.job{
	margin-bottom:20px;
}
.job dd dt{
	border:none;
	font-weight:bold;
	padding-top:5px;
}

.table2{
	background-color:F67515;
}

.table3{
	background-color:#66c300;
}
.divPoint{
	background-position:5px 5px;
	background-repeat:no-repeat;
	padding:5px 10px 5px 95px;
	margin:20px 0;
	height:95px;
	overflow:visible;
}
.divPoint dl.point dt{
	font-size:120%;
	font-weight:bold;
}

